Netflix live-action Cowboy Bebop announced

After many years [and the Success of john Cammerons' Battle angel Alita no doult helping] the American website hollywood reporter has confirmed the cast of the new live-action adaptation of the cult anime series Cowboy Bebop.

The series, currently commissioned by the streaming service Netflix, will star:

John Cho (recognisable to fans of the J.J Abrams Star Trek films as Sulu) will play the main character, bounty hunter Spike Spiegel.

Luke Cage actor Mustafa Shakir will appear as Spike's partner Jet Black.

Jurassic World: Fallen Kingdom's Daniella Pineda will play con-artist and femme fatale Fae Valentine.

Alex Hassel rounds out the cast as a crime boss and Spike's rival Vicious.

Finally Alex Garcia Lopez, who directed the Marvel/Netflix series Daredevil, Luke Cage and Cloak and Dagger will be directing the first two episode of the 10 episode series. If his work on the prison fate in Daredevil season 3's episode "Blindsided" is anything to go by, the action sequences should be outstanding.
